    Need Help With a Weird Computer Problem

    I'm running Windows XP on a Dell Pentium 4 Computer.

    On a couple of occassions today, I have re-booted my machine. When I got to the log-on screen and attempted to log-on, an error message pops up that says "Visual Basic Runtime Error." It proceeds to describe a problem with the logon.exe file. Then Windows kicks out to the all blue screen and says: "Logon Error" and gives a code of "c000021a" (Fatal System Error).

    NOTE: This does not happen every time I boot the machine. I tried to recreate the error and it gave the same error about two times out of ten reboots. It does not seem to make a difference whether it's a hard boot or a soft boot.

    A friend of mine suggested running Checkdisk, and I will do that when I get home. Anyone have any other ideas? I went to Microsoft's Knowledge Base, but didn't seem to find exactly the right information.

    Re: Need Help With a Weird Computer Problem

    Here are a few links to knowledge base articles that may be related to the problem you are having. To sum up the problem, basically something is causing logon.exe to fail; Winxp can't/won't start without it.
